GDP Deflator in Norway decreased to 100 points in the third quarter of 2025 from 100.40 points in the second quarter of 2025. GDP Deflator in Norway averaged 49.38 points from 1978 until 2025, reaching an all time high of 125.90 points in the third quarter of 2022 and a record low of 13.50 points in the first quarter of 1978. source: Statistics Norway
